
Advisory Board Member
Steve Wills is Senior Director of Regulatory Affairs for Ameren Missouri. He has been with Ameren in a variety of roles of increasing responsibility since 2004. Prior to coming to Ameren, Steve received a Master’s of Business Administration degree from Saint Louis University with an emphasis in Economics and then spent two years at Laclede Gas Company (now Spire) as a Senior Analyst in the Financial Services department.
At Ameren, Steve has gained broad experience related to utility regulation and energy markets. He has had roles related to energy trading analytics, structured transaction pricing, load research, load forecasting, weather normalization, resource planning, energy efficiency, regulated ratemaking, and tariff design and implementation. In 2015, Steve became the Director of Rates & Analysis for Ameren Illinois, where he oversaw class cost of service studies, revenue allocation, rate design, and administration of the company’s rates, tariffs, and riders. In 2016 Steve moved to a similar role at Ameren Missouri, and subsequently took on oversight of all state regulated activities for the company when he was promoted to his current role in 2022. Steve frequently testifies as an expert witness on behalf of the company in front of the Missouri Public Service Commission.
